**Alert: RestockPlanner queue backlog**

Heads up — the Vendomatic restock planner has fallen behind on route calculations, so plugin webhooks may fire late or out of order. Your integration shouldn't assume ordering here anyway, but double-check retry logic. If your plugin is stuck waiting on planner callbacks for more than an hour, ping the platform crew at the address below.

escalation mailbox, yajeg-bageg: quenax.olidor@lumiccorp.internal

Subject: Waveform preview shipping Thursday

Team — audio waveform preview for Clipdeck lands in this week's release. Rendering moved server-side; peaks are precomputed on upload, so scrubbing is instant. Known gap: mono files over 90 minutes fall back to the old canvas renderer. Mara owns the fallback fix, targeting next cycle. QA signed off on Safari and the Lumen desktop shell. No flag needed; it's on by default. Build for verification is below.

trace token, fafog-kageg: htk4_98e6

## Idempotency Keys for Payment Retries (Lumopay)

Every retry of a charge request must reuse the original idempotency key; generating a new key on retry can produce duplicate charges. Keys are scoped per merchant and expire after 48 hours. Reviewers should verify keys are derived server-side, never from client input. The full key-generation specification and threat model are maintained on the internal page.

dashboard of kaguf-tawip = https://vault.merlaqsys.test/issue

## Relevance tuning notes — Querna search

Quick context for your review: we bumped the synonym expansion weights last sprint and flattened the recency boost so stale docs stop outranking fresh ones. Nothing here touches auth paths, but the tuning service does read its knobs from the shared config store, so worth eyeballing. None of the values are secret, just sensitive to typos. The current live tuning configuration is listed below.

deployment values, yadug-bawif:
[framir]
team = pelox
access_code = ac_a38ab2
owner = tamion.julael
host = framir.tolvaqlabs.test
port = 11211
peer = tammir.zemvargrid.local
salt = 2215ef03
pin = 1541